Copthorne Hotel London Gatwick - Crawley (West Sussex)
51.1325686273878, -0.124819278717041The 4-star Copthorne Hotel London Gatwick Crawley features a tennis court and a solarium and sits near a train station. This stunning hotel is conveniently situated around a 10-minute drive from Tilgate, and offers a swimming pool along with cots and high chairs for guests with children.
Location
The accommodation is nestled approximately 25 minutes' walk from Worth Park and within a 10-minute drive of Crawley Borough Council. The hotel is a few minutes' drive from Box Hill. This Crawley property allows you to enjoy such natural sights as Tulleys Farm 2.6 km away.
For those travelling from afar, London Gatwick airport is 10 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
Some rooms provide tea/coffee making equipment as well as Wi-Fi and a TV set to help you enjoy your stay. They have a stylish interior. Guests can take advantage of views of the garden.
Eat & Drink
The Copthorne Hotel London Gatwick Crawley features an à la carte restaurant serving British dishes. Such food, as snacks and a barbecue, is available in the snack bar. This Crawley property is around 20 minutes' drive from the bar White Swan Pub.
Leisure & Business
A sauna and spa therapy can be provided at a surcharge. The tranquil Copthorne Hotel London Gatwick offers options for sports and relaxation in a solarium, sauna facilities, and an indoor pool, or at a gym area and a fitness studio. The Copthorne Hotel London Gatwick features sports activities such as squash, tennis, and golf for all guests.
